    1150 ring end gaps

    I am just preparing my 1199 kit. The cylinders have all been honed and I have a brand new set of weisco rings. My Suzuki manual says end gaps should be .7mm on the first and second rings. I thought I read somewhere that the gap on the second ring should be slightly larger than the top one. Anyone confirm that and how far down the cylinder do I push the rings for measurement. Thanks, Bob

      The .7mm in the Suzuki manual is the service limit...meaning wore out. Do not gap to that spec.

          On a street motor the ring end gaps should be .003 X bore diameter for the top ring & .004 X the bore diameter for the second ring. Therefore, 2.992 bore diameter = .008976, or .009 THOUSANDTHS end gap for the top rings & .011968, or .012 THOUSANDTHS for the second rings. Hope this helps, Ray.
